Why FIN Exists
Foreign investors rarely suffer from a lack of Tanzanian opportunities. They suffer from a shortage of independent, decision-grade local visibility: the gap between what an opportunity appears to be from abroad and what is workable on the ground.
We do not ask you to rely on an opportunity's own story. We establish an independent local view, separate confirmed facts from unresolved questions, and help make the decision defensible to your board, principal, or investment committee.

The Operating Model
FIN is deliberately built around the mandate rather than a fixed bench of generalists.
The core office owns the investor relationship, verification process, decision visibility and coordination. Where a mandate requires specialist capability, FIN coordinates the appropriate technical, legal, commercial, sector or field expertise around the specific question being examined.
This allows the investor to maintain one coherent line of sight while specialist work remains specialist.
